23.3 C
New York
July 1, 2025

Related posts

ESA Releases Report on the Space Economy 2024

TheWorldsNews

New Laser Station Lights The Way To Space Debris Reduction

TheWorldsNews

DND IDEaS Program Invested $75.8M in 2022-2023

TheWorldsNews

Pin It on Pinterest

Share This